navigator.geolocation is not removed on insecure origins. Unlike navigator.share and navigator.clipboard, it is not [SecureContext] in its IDL — Chrome and Firefox keep the property and fail the call with PERMISSION_DENIED (Chrome additionally logs its own deprecation warning). So on http://192.168.1.2:5017 this detect passes, getCurrentPosition runs, and the reader is told "Location permission was refused. Allow it in your site settings, then try again." — a false claim they will act on and find nothing, which is the exact failure ADR-0142 exists to prevent.

Test window.isSecureContext first and return insecure before touching the API at all; keep the existing check afterwards for the genuinely-unsupported case. That also avoids Chrome's own console warning, since the call never happens.

ADR-0167's "it is not merely restricted over plain HTTP — it is absent. navigator.geolocation is undefined, not a callable that fails" needs correcting with it, as does the comment block at the top of this file.

Non-blocking, and not yours to fix here. alt does nothing for a divIcon: the vendored Leaflet applies it only to an IMG ("IMG"===i.tagName&&(i.alt=t.alt||"")), and currentLocationIcon returns a divIcon, so this string never reaches the DOM. Harmless for the dot itself — it is decorative, non-interactive and out of the tab order by design, so having no accessible name is arguably correct — but the option reads as though it provides one.

The reason to mention it: line 798 does the same thing for place markers, alt: marker.label || "Marker", and colouredPinIcon is also a divIcon. So the group-and-place label ADR-0098 says is "read aloud by a screen reader" is not reaching assistive technology either. That is a pre-existing defect, out of scope for this PR, and worth a ticket.

2. Both failures are one mechanism, and it is a real-time delay against a 1 s budget. ModalOverlay.RequestCloseAsync awaits Task.Delay(ClosingAnimationDurationMilliseconds) = 200 ms, and both test classes stub prefers-reduced-motion to false (GroupFormPanelTests:45, DrawerAuthenticatedTests:43), so the delay genuinely runs. Both tests then wait on bUnit's WaitForAssertion with its default 1 s budget — closed.ShouldBeTrue() after the close, and .modal-overlay-panel disappearing after the close. A 5× margin, and the first thing to go when the runner is starved. That is why these two failed together and nothing else did.
